Terrorists and gangsters are spoiling the atmosphere of the country by sitting abroad, real passports are easily available in fake names.

New Delhi: From terrorists to gangsters involved in anti-national activities, they are spoiling the atmosphere of the country by sitting abroad. Even small-time criminals are carrying out murders and firings from across the seven seas. Extortion calls worth crores of rupees are coming to businessmen from foreign countries. Indian security agencies and police of various states are looking helpless in front of all this. After all, how do wanted terrorists, gangsters and small-time criminals succeed in escaping abroad in serious cases? The first process to flee abroad is to get a passport made. It is not easy for the common man even today. A Delhi Police officer says that the work of passport verification in the capital is handled by a special branch. Even if all the documents are correct, the policeman doing the verification demands Rs 1000 to 2000. As if this is his/her fee. If there is any deficiency in the documents, then this amount is increased accordingly. They also take advantage of the instant processing of passport, because under this the verification happens later. Fake documents were prepared for dreaded gangster Lawrence Bishnoi’s brother Anmol Bishnoi, nephew Sachin Bishnoi and gangster Rohit Godara. The real passports of all three were made from the regional office of Delhi in fake names. One and a half lakh rupees were given for one passport.

absconding by taking donkey route
Wanted gangsters or miscreants are successful in flying from airports of other states of the country by making passports in fake names. An expenditure of around Rs 10 lakh has been reported for this. There are many gangs which are even providing fake visas. They are sent to Canada and Gulf countries by taking student visa or visitor visa. From there they take the donkey route (through forest or road) and enter America or other European countries. Ecuador, Bolivia and Guyana give easy visas to Indians. Brazil and Venezuela also offer tourist visas. The route depends on the agent, the gang to which he/she has links, will send through the same route.

They also fly from Nepal
Many wanted criminals of the country are taking advantage of the open border between India and Nepal. Enter Nepal by road. From Kathmandu airport they fly to Dubai, from where they fly to other countries. Police officers say that many such gangs are active, who work to arrange flights from Nepal to other countries. They charge Rs 15 lakh for this. After paying this amount, the person flying is given VVIP treatment, after which he/she is able to board the flight directly without any scrutiny. In this way many Indian wanted criminals have succeeded in escaping abroad. Last year it was revealed that 368 gangsters and terrorists of India had fled abroad through fake passports.
